History Nesnesi
History Nesnesi
History Nesnesi, kullanıcıların (tarayıcı pencerelerinde) ziyaret ettiği URL'leri içerir.
History Nesnesi, window nesnesinin bir parçasıdır ve window.history özelliği ile erişilebilir.
Not:History Nesnesi için açık bir standart yok, ancak tüm tarayıcılar bu nesneyi destekler.
History Nesnesi Özellikleri
Özellik | Tanım |
---|---|
length | Tarayıcı geçmişindeki URL sayısını döndürür. |
History Nesnesi Yöntemleri
Yöntem | Tanım |
---|---|
back() | History listesindeki bir önceki URL'yi yüklemek. |
forward() | History listesindeki bir sonraki URL'yi yüklemek. |
go() | History listesindeki belirli bir sayfayı yüklemek. |
History Nesnesi Tanımı
History Nesnesi, başlangıçta pencerelerin tarayıcı geçmişini temsil etmek için tasarlanmıştır. Ancak gizlilik nedenlerinden ötürü, History Nesnesi artık gerçekten ziyaret edilmiş olan URL'leri scriptlere erişim sağlamamaktadır. Tekrar kullanılan tek fonksiyon back()veforward() ve go() Yöntem.
Örnek
Aşağıdaki satır kodu, geri butonuna tıklama işlemi ile aynı işlemi gerçekleştirir:
history.back()
Aşağıdaki satır kodu, iki kez geri butonuna tıklama işlemi ile aynı işlemi gerçekleştirir:
history.go(-2)